Summary of the Action"}, {"bbox": [96, 403, 1137, 669], "category": "Text", "text": "The action will be in line with Sustainable Development Goal 16. It is also aligned with Rwanda's Vision 2050. The action will contribute to Rwanda's priorities under the National Strategy for Transformation (NST1), Pillar 3-Transformational Governance, through the implementation of the Justice, Reconciliation, Law and Order Sector (JRLOS) Strategic Plan 2018-2024. In particular the focus will be on (i) Strengthening Justice, Law and Order; (ii) Supporting peaceful reconciliation by the reintegration of prisoners and ex-perpetrators of genocide into society and (iii) Raising the voice of civil society and strengthening accountability of public service delivery towards citizens. The action will contribute to implementing the EU Human Rights Country Strategy for Rwanda, notably its objective regarding strengthening the respect of Human Rights, and in strengthening civil society. It will, in particular, respond to the Government's priorities accepted under the 2021 Universal Periodic Review at the Human Rights Council."}, {"bbox": [96, 681, 1135, 1109], "category": "Text", "text": "The first component of the action will improve the professionalism and skills of the Justice sector main actors, namely the Ministry of Justice, the Judiciary, the National Prosecution Authority, the Rwanda Investigation Bureau (RIB), the Rwanda National Police (RNP) and the National Commission for Human Rights (NCHR). Under this component the action will improve the delivery of timely justice aiming at the reduction of the backlog of cases, modernizing the justice system, and improving access to quality justice. The action will place a strong emphasis on inclusion of the most vulnerable persons, victims of Gender-based violence (GBV) and minors, particularly in rural areas. The performance of the criminal justice system will be further addressed with a Twinning component between the Police and Rwanda Investigation Bureau (RIB) on the one hand, and EU Member States counterpart bodies on the other, with the goal of reinforcing human-rights based approaches and improving their prevention, detection and investigation capacity. The action will also support digitalization solutions as a means for accessibility and efficiency of the justice system. Complementary interventions will include the streamline of legal aid support to ensure universal and affordable justice for all and awareness campaigns. Support will also be dedicated to the National Commission for Human Rights (NCHR) for the promotion and protection of human rights, and in particular, to the National Preventive Mechanism to investigate human rights violations, in order to assist Rwandan authorities in implementing their international obligations and to raise awareness."}, {"bbox": [96, 1126, 1135, 1339], "category": "Text", "text": "The second component will focus on Reconciliation, Rehabilitation and Unity through support to Rwanda Correctional Service (RCS) and civil society. This component of the action will strengthen the provision of technical, vocational, education and training (TVET) in prisons. Such capacity building will provide a great number of prisoners and former genocide perpetrators with hands-on skills to reduce recidivism once reintegrated into their communities. The action will also tackle an important aspect of sustainable reconciliation and peace building through socio psychological healing, reconciliation and rehabilitation processes at community level, implemented through civil society organisations. The action will aim at building stronger linkages between RCS and civil society organisations."}, {"bbox": [96, 1351, 1135, 1485], "category": "Text", "text": "The third component of the action will focus on voice and accountability of civil society. The approach will involve working both on the demand and supply side of accountability. Support will be directed to civil society organisations (CSOs) for strengthening their capacity to work with citizens. It will also focus on developing CSOs' capacity to increase justice delivery and foster accountability to citizens. The action will promote spaces for citizens, empowering them with knowledge and capacity on issues of accountability."}, {"bbox": [96, 1510, 1135, 1644], "category": "Text", "text": "The action will leverage both on the EU previous programmes (11th EDF Accountable Democratic Governance Programme) and Dutch cooperation in the justice sector over the past twenty years. It will contribute to progress on Sustainable Development Goal 16 (SDG) and fulfilment of political, economic and social rights, gender equality, in line with Rwanda's international human rights commitments. The programme will follow a comprehensive approach of the whole justice sector including reconciliation and rehabilitation of prisoners.
